Attitude of Consumers Towards Shopping Malls in Ernakulum District
Journal Title: International Journal of Management, IT and Engineering - Year 2017, Vol 7, Issue 4
Abstract
A shopping mall is one or more buildings forming a complex of shops, planned, developed, owned and managed as a single property representing merchandisers, with interconnecting walkways enabling visitors to walk from unit to unit, with on-site parking . Aim The current study has been undertaken to analyze the attitude of consumers towards shopping malls in Ernakulum district. Materials and Methods The scope of the study is confined to the attitude of the consumers of various shops of Lulu Mall, and Oberon Mall, Edappally. For the purpose of the study 50 consumers were selected through convenience sampling method. Analysis was done via statistical software 17.0. using statistical tool, viz percentages, rank test and chi-square test were used. Results The study revealed that the majority of the consumers were femalesand were of the age group of 20 to 40years. The study revealed that the factors viz. entertainments,safety, parking facility, restaurants, escalator\lift facilities, electronic payment systems etc influenced them to shop at malls. Food products and jewellery were the most preferred products of the consumers of the shopping malls. Conclusion Food products and jewellery were the most preferred products of the consumers of the shopping malls.
